Output 21fa2d50052fb54354bfa6703f8182e25a349b4f87c842b42d989820cdf9c998:0

value
28214800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c6fdaf6d208c4cd45d557a08860b1dcff778a3 OP_EQUALVERIFY OP_CHECKSIG
address
1MDeiXfU2Hcs25kEz8JLEhNMSqSe4Way6z
transaction
21fa2d50052fb54354bfa6703f8182e25a349b4f87c842b42d989820cdf9c998
spent
true